Summary:
Now in its 6th Edition, this classic text lauded by "Archives of Ophthalmology" as "the gold standard for strabismus textbooks," continues to provide you with everything you need to diagnose and treat the full spectrum of disorders. This new edition is simply the best and most comprehensive resource available in the field of strabismus. It presents the latest information on the pharmacological treatment of amblyopia, chemodenveration in place of surgery for certain types of strabismus, use of botulinum toxin for treatment of extraocular muscles, and much more! The 6th Edition of this complete and extensive reference has been fully updated and expanded to offer the latest information on both the theoretical and practical aspects of diagnosis and management. Readers will find highly illustrated and extensively referenced descriptions of state-of-the-art procedures, presented in an easy-to-read format.
